Melissa Concho Antonio (b. 1965) is a daughter of Gilbert and Lillie Concho and married to Daniel Antonio.  She is a sister-in-law of Frederica Antonio.  This piece is coil-built from native clay and painted with bee-weed (black) and additional clay slips.  It is a classic water jar shape with a high shoulder and short neck.  The rim has a mountain and rain design. There are flute players swirling from the top to the base.  The remainder is painted with a checkerboard pattern.  There are cloud and rain designs extending downward.  It is intricate and eye-dazzling for its size.  It is signed on the bottom, “M. C. Antonio”.
